Output f130320c40333f46561abda34e69016db302fd66104ede79e11543a33cb968b9:3

value
642970000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25a251d4dedd7e7a794a3c42bfb21f7c7543a422 OP_EQUAL
address
3581Nos1b9iZ9ZUvay3xq17DZjgvujmEAt
transaction
f130320c40333f46561abda34e69016db302fd66104ede79e11543a33cb968b9
spent
true